The Real Challenge: Sustaining Momentum

Growth during coaching is often transformative, but the real test comes after the sessions end. How do you maintain the momentum when the regular check-ins are gone? How do you ensure that boldness doesn’t fade back into old habits?

For Kelly, this phase was just as critical as the breakthroughs she experienced during coaching. She wasn’t just building confidence—she was embedding it into her leadership identity.

Kindle: Fueling Long-Term Growth

The final stage of the SPARK model is Kindle, designed to ignite a lasting drive for growth. Here’s how Kelly ensured her transformation wasn’t temporary:

  1. Establishing a Growth Framework: Kelly and I co-created a one-year development plan with clear, quarterly milestones. This wasn’t just a list of goals—it was a roadmap to maintain focus, track progress, and celebrate wins. Each milestone built on the last, reinforcing her growth step by step.
  2. Finding a Mentor: To continue receiving guidance and feedback, Kelly identified a senior leader within her organization to act as a mentor. This relationship provided ongoing support, accountability, and a sounding board for new challenges and opportunities.
  3. Embedding Reflection Practices: We introduced reflective practices, like journaling and weekly self-assessments, to help Kelly stay connected to her growth journey. By regularly reflecting on her wins, challenges, and lessons learned, she maintained clarity and purpose.
